Honey Butter Chicken

Honey Butter Chicken is a mouthwatering dish that combines sweet and savory flavors for a quick weeknight meal. Ready in under 30 minutes, this recipe features perfectly fried chicken pieces coated in a luscious honey butter sauce. Serve it over rice with sautéed green beans for a complete family-friendly dinner that’s sure to impress!

Ingredients

Scale
  • 1/4 cup all-purpose flour
  • 1/2 tsp garlic powder
  • 1/4 tsp cayenne pepper
  • 1/2 tsp onion powder
  • 1 tsp salt
  • 1/4 tsp ground black pepper
  • 1 lb chicken breasts, cut into 1-inch pieces
  • 1 tbsp unsalted butter
  • 1 tbsp canola oil
  • 5 tbsp butter, room temperature
  • 1/2 cup honey
  • 1 tbsp soy sauce
  • 1 tbsp apple cider vinegar

Instructions

  1. In a large bowl, mix flour, garlic powder, cayenne pepper, onion powder, salt, and black pepper. Coat the chicken pieces in the flour mixture.
  2. Heat butter and oil in a cast iron skillet over medium heat. Fry the chicken for 2-3 minutes on each side until golden brown. Remove and set aside.
  3. Reduce heat to low; melt remaining butter in the skillet. Stir in honey, soy sauce, apple cider vinegar, salt, and black pepper until smooth.
  4. Mix in the fried chicken until well coated in the sauce. Let cool for 5 minutes before serving.
  5. Serve with white rice and sautéed green beans, garnished with sliced green onions.
